Roisin Murphy To Release New Album 'Take Her Up To Monto' In July

Tuesday, 19 April 2016 Written by Laura Johnson

Róisín Murphy will release her new album, 'Take Her Up To Monto', this summer.

The follow up to 2015's 'Hairless Toys' is set to arrive on July 8 through Play It Again Sam. Meanwhile, check a new song, Mastermind, and the tracklist below following their unveiling over at Pitchfork.

  1. Mastermind 
  2. Pretty Gardens 
  3. Thoughts Wasted 
  4. Lip Service 
  5. Ten Miles High 
  6. Whatever 
  7. Romantic Comedy 
  8. Nervous Sleep
  9. Sitting and Counting

Murphy has a run of summer festival appearances lined up, including Glastonbury in June, Longitude in July, the Big Feastival in August and Festival No.6 and On Blackheath in September.
